Escape window installation services involve the process of adding or upgrading windows that provide an emergency exit in residential and commercial properties. These windows are designed to meet specific safety standards, ensuring they can be easily opened from the inside without the use of tools or keys. The installation process typically includes assessing the existing window opening, preparing the opening to meet safety requirements, and fitting the new escape window securely to ensure functionality and compliance. Proper installation is essential to guarantee that the window operates correctly in emergency situations while maintaining the structural integrity of the building.
This service addresses several common problems, including inadequate egress options in older properties, windows that are difficult to open, or spaces where existing windows do not meet current safety codes. An improperly functioning or non-compliant window can pose safety risks during emergencies, such as fires or other urgent situations. Material Costs - The cost for materials like glass and framing typically ranges from $200 to $600 per window. Prices vary based on the quality and type of glass selected for the escape window installation.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$150 and $400 per window. The total cost depends on the complexity of the installation and local labor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its or structural modifications,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all expense. These charges depend on the specific requirements of each project.
Overall Cost Range - The complete cost for escape window installation services typically ranges from $400 to $1,200 per window. Actual prices vary based on materials, labor, and project scope in the Estero, FL area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
